class GeoUtm::Ellipsoid
This class represents the ellipsoid used to convert from latitude/longitude into UTM coordinates. All operations default to using WGS-84.

lookup(name)
click to toggle source
Find a preconfigured ellipsoid @param [String] the name of the ellipsoid. Spaces, case and `-` are ignored @return [Ellipsoid]
# File lib/geoutm/ellipsoid.rb, line 46 def Ellipsoid.lookup(name) result = List[normalize_name(name.to_s)] raise GeoUtmException, 'Ellipsoid not found: ' + name.to_s unless result result end
